Blockchain and crypto projects rely on the expertise and innovation of developers. These professionals are responsible for creating the software systems that power cryptocurrencies and the underlying blockchain technology.

For these projects to thrive, it is crucial to promote a strong and engaged developer community. A thriving developer community can lead to increased usage, more robust ecosystems and a pipeline of new ideas.

Building a successful developer community requires a deep understanding of developers’ unique needs and motivations. Developers are a highly skilled and in-demand group, and they need to feel valued and supported in order to contribute to a project’s success.

In this article, we’ll explore 8 tips for building a thriving developer community, as shared by Nader Dabit an influential participant in the blockchain community, who is the director of developer relations at Aave, Lens Protocol, and the founder of DeveloperDAO.

From providing resources and encouraging collaboration, to creating a sense of belonging and recognizing contributions, these tips can help blockchain and crypto projects create a strong, engaged developer community that drives innovation and success.

1.) Build something people want

Building something people want is the first step in creating a thriving developer community for a blockchain or crypto project. Thorough market research and engagement with potential users is essential to understand the needs and pain points of the target group.

Building an MVP helps test the product in the market and gather feedback while involving developers in the development process, it can help identify potential problems and ensure scalability.

By building a product that meets the needs of the target audience, developers will be motivated to contribute, leading to a more engaged and successful community.

2.) Create good documentation

Good documentation is critical to attracting and retaining top developer talent in blockchain and crypto projects.

Clear and concise documentation explaining the project’s architecture, APIs and SDKs, as well as detailed instructions for setting up a development environment, can make a project more accessible and productive for developers.

Organizing the documentation in a logical and intuitive way with clear examples and explanations can help developers of all skill levels understand the project. Creating great documentation supports developer engagement and drives innovation.

3.) Provide a place for conversations

Developers often rely on communication platforms like Telegram, Discord, and WhatsApp to collaborate and share ideas. Allowing space for these conversations is critical to building a thriving developer community.

These platforms allow developers to ask questions, share insights, and collaborate on projects, which helps build a sense of community and foster engagement. By creating a space for communication, blockchain and crypto projects can create a community-driven culture that supports innovation and growth.

For a strong community, you want to ensure that everyone participates and that no one person or moderator drives all the conversations or activities.

There’s a lot to do, including creating and delivering high-quality documentation, creating tutorials and videos, collaborating with creators and builders in the ecosystem, speaking and teaching at conferences and events.

To optimize for many-to-many relationships between developers in a community, you need to create an environment that promotes collaboration and communication. This can be achieved by creating a central hub for interaction, encouraging participation, promoting diversity and fostering a culture of collaboration. By doing so, blockchain and crypto projects can create a thriving developer community that supports innovation and growth.

One way to optimize for many-to-many relationships is by identifying and incentivizing superstars. These could be OSS (open source software) developers, blog writers, YouTubers, speakers, teachers, successful teams building software with your product, or trusted developers with their own large networks.

One tip for achieving this that has become popular is through the use of ambassador programs, which give builders exclusive privileges, special Discord roles, swag and VIP access to private events.

You can also do things like have profilers on your team share their work and win publicly, create private one-on-one communication channels with engineering or management support, or simply pay or hire them on a contract basis.

Here is an overview of the tips you need to encourage those who stand out in society:

  • Ambassador programs
  • Private Telegram groups
  • Event invitations and sponsorship
  • Hire them
  • Let high profile people share their winnings publicly
  • Send them Swag and other rewards

6.) Prioritize diversity

Prioritizing diversity in the blockchain and crypto industry is critical to building a thriving developer community.

This requires a conscious effort to create an inclusive environment, actively seek out diverse candidates, promote diversity and inclusion in company culture and policy, and address issues of bias and discrimination.

It is important not to include different people just for the sake of it, but to make sure that all kinds of people benefit from the community.

7.) Being transparent

A big part of creating thriving communities is actually building trust, but being transparent stands out.

Building trust begins with openness. Blockchain and crypto projects must be transparent about their goals, strategies and decision-making processes. This includes sharing information about their team, their roadmap and their progress.

8.) Hire developer relations personnel

Finally, hiring a developer relations team (DevRel) is critical to building and maintaining a thriving developer community in the blockchain and crypto space.

DevRel teams are responsible for creating and fostering relationships with developers, advocating for their needs and interests, and providing support and resources to help them succeed.

DevRel teams should also have a mix of technical and non-technical expertise, as they will be responsible for advocating for developers both within the company and in the wider blockchain and crypto community.

This means hiring people with experience in software development, as well as those with expertise in community management, marketing and public relations.

Prioritizing developer needs, fostering relationships, and providing support and resources are key to building a thriving developer community in the blockchain and crypto space.
